GLOBAL CRISES, FUEL TAXES WAGE WAR ON YOUR WALLET

The Mercury

|

March 11, 2026

THE finances of the everyday South African are under siege, caught in a crossfire of global aggression and dubious domestic policy.

It is a dual assault that threatens to push the consumer to the breaking point, reminding us that a crisis ignited thousands of kilometres away can have the same painful impact as a directive issued from Pretoria.
